  2. Google Calendar - Known for its robust scheduling capabilities, Google Calendar also offers reliable alarm features. With the ability to sync across devices, you can set reminders and alarms for important meetings or deadlines easily. It's ideal for users already in the Google ecosystem.
    Website: https://calendar.google.com
  3. Microsoft To Do - This tool combines task management with effective alarm functions. You can set specific reminders for tasks, ensuring nothing slips through the cracks. It's especially useful if you're using other Microsoft services.
    Website: https://todo.microsoft.com
  4. Evernote - While primarily a note-taking app, Evernote also includes alarm features. You can set reminders directly on notes, making it easier to remember everything from grocery lists to work projects. It's a great choice for those who love keeping their tasks and reminders organized in one place.
    Website: https://evernote.com
  5. Todoist - Another popular option for task management, Todoist integrates with several platforms to offer seamless alarm functions. Whether it's a daily to-do list or a long-term project, Todoist helps you stay on track.
    Website: https://todoist.com
  6. Slack - Primarily a communication tool, Slack allows you to set reminders within your chats. This feature is perfect for teams who need to keep track of tasks and deadlines collaboratively. It's a smart option if you're already using Slack for workplace communications.
    Website: https://slack.com
  7. Trello - Known for its visual project management capabilities, Trello also offers reminder features. You can attach alarms to specific cards, helping you manage projects efficiently. It's particularly useful for visual planners.
